当前位置: 主页 > PLC控制

现有程序中怎么加暂停

一套自动程序,想在中间停止时,检测工件,检测后在继续加工。中间类似暂停程序段,请问高手怎么加?

最佳答案

1、一般在机制为周期扫描的PLC中,对与用户控制程序尽量不采用使CPU进行停机或暂停的方法,因为许多PLC只有STOP指令,但没有RUN指令。因此,最常用的就是终止当前扫描周期,这样相当于可以使CPU实现“动停”的效果,即CPU不扫描(不执行)相关的用户程序。
2、条件结束:
条件结束指令(END)根据前面的逻辑关系终止当前扫描周期。可以在主程序中使用条件结束指令,但不能在子程序或中断程序中使用该命令。
3、相关指令见:
<S7-200可编程控制器系统手册>下载
htTP://www.ad.siemens.com.cn/download/SearchResult.ASpx?searchText=1017

提问者对于答案的评价:
谢谢您的回答我会继续学习的

专家置评

已阅,最佳答案正确。

  • 关注微信

猜你喜欢

微信公众号